[Pkg-fglrx-devel] r1364 - fglrx-driver/trunk/debian
Andreas Beckmann
anbe at moszumanska.debian.org
Wed Apr 23 15:05:22 UTC 2014
Author: anbe
Date: 2014-04-23 15:05:22 +0000 (Wed, 23 Apr 2014)
New Revision: 1364
Modified:
fglrx-driver/trunk/debian/rules
Log:
add support for RC versions
Modified: fglrx-driver/trunk/debian/rules
===================================================================
--- fglrx-driver/trunk/debian/rules 2014-04-23 14:39:44 UTC (rev 1363)
+++ fglrx-driver/trunk/debian/rules 2014-04-23 15:05:22 UTC (rev 1364)
@@ -202,8 +202,8 @@
INSTALLER_SUFFIX ?= linux-x86.x86_64
INSTALLER_SUFFIX.zip ?= $(INSTALLER_SUFFIX)
INSTALLER_SUFFIX.run ?= $(INSTALLER_SUFFIX)
-INSTALLER_ZIP ?= $(INSTALLER_PREFIX.zip)-$(UPSTREAM_VERSION.zip)-$(INSTALLER_SUFFIX.zip).zip
-INSTALLER ?= $(INSTALLER_PREFIX.run)-$(UPSTREAM_VERSION.run)-$(INSTALLER_SUFFIX.run).run
+INSTALLER_ZIP ?= $(INSTALLER_PREFIX.zip)-$(UPSTREAM_VERSION.zip)$(if $(INSTALLER_SUFFIX.zip),-)$(INSTALLER_SUFFIX.zip).zip
+INSTALLER ?= $(INSTALLER_PREFIX.run)-$(UPSTREAM_VERSION.run)$(if $(INSTALLER_SUFFIX.run),-)$(INSTALLER_SUFFIX.run).run
URL_PATH ?= www2.ati.com/drivers/$(if $(findstring beta,$(NEW_UPSTREAM_VERSION)),beta,linux)
CACHEDIR ?= /tmp
NEW_UPSTREAM_VERSION ?= $(patsubst VER=%,%,$(filter VER=%,$(DEB_BUILD_OPTIONS)))
@@ -211,7 +211,8 @@
UPSTREAM_VERSION.run ?= $(or $(patsubst RVER=%,%,$(filter RVER=%,$(DEB_BUILD_OPTIONS))),$(NEW_UPSTREAM_VERSION))
INTERNAL_VERSION := $(shell test ! -s $(INSTALLER) || sh $(INSTALLER) --info | sed -n '/^Identification:/ s/[^0-9]*//p')
FIXUP_BETA ?= $(subst -beta,~beta,$(subst beta-,beta,$(subst betav,beta,$1)))
-REAL_UPSTREAM_VERSION ?= $(subst -,.,$(call FIXUP_BETA,$(NEW_UPSTREAM_VERSION)))
+FIXUP_RC ?= $(subst -rc,~rc,$(subst rcv,rc,$(subst rc-,rc,$1)))
+REAL_UPSTREAM_VERSION ?= $(subst -,.,$(call FIXUP_RC,$(call FIXUP_BETA,$(NEW_UPSTREAM_VERSION))))
get-orig-source-checks:
test -z "$(NEW_UPSTREAM_VERSION)" && echo "Version not defined" && exit 1 || true
More information about the Pkg-fglrx-devel
mailing list